Conformational Studies of Phenyl- and (1-Pyrenyl)triarylmethylcarbenium Ions: Semiempirical Calculations and NMR Investigations under Stable Ion Conditions
Hansen, Poul Erik,Spanget-Larsen, Jens,Laali, Kenneth K.
, p. 1827 - 1835 (2007/10/03)
Highly stable crowded carbenium ions such as (1-pyrenyl)diphenylmethylcarbenium ion (2) and 1,6- (3) and 1,8-bis(diphenylmethylenium)pyrene [dication] (4) and their dibrominated analogues (3Br and 4Br) have been studied at low and at ambient temperatures.
